About this sunscreen

Bioderma Photoderm Leb Sun Cream is a hybrid sunscreen using the modern filters Tinosorb M, avobenzone, and Tinosorb S for broad spectrum coverage. It has a balanced finish, low white cast, and a lightweight feel that wears comfortably. It is generally gentle on skin, with low sting and low pore-clogging risk, though it rates only okay under makeup. With excellent protection and a high score of 91/100, it is one of the stronger picks in this group.

Does Bioderma Photoderm Leb leave a white cast?

It has a low white cast. The hybrid formula uses modern filters like Tinosorb M and Tinosorb S, so it generally wears clear on skin.

Is the Bioderma Photoderm Leb Sun Cream mineral or chemical?

It is a hybrid sunscreen built mainly on modern chemical filters, including Tinosorb M, avobenzone, and Tinosorb S. It is not a pure mineral formula.

Is Bioderma Photoderm Leb a good sunscreen?

Yes, it scores 91 out of 100, one of the highest here. It pairs excellent protection with a lightweight, low-cast wear.
